Thomas "Tommy" Benford (April 19, 1905 - March 24, 1994) was a prominent African American jazz drummer.
Tommy Benford was the younger brother of tuba player Bill Benford. He studied music at the Jenkins Orphanage located in South Carolina. He went on tour with the school band including traveling to England in 1914.
In 1920, he was working with the Green River Minstrel Show.
Benford recorded with Jelly Roll Morton in 1928 and 1930.
In later life he played with Stan McDonald. Benford died on March 24, 1994.
